Apple tree p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ping apple trees to promote healthy growth and maximize fruit production. This process typically includes removing dead, damaged, or diseased branches, as well as thinning out crowded areas to improve air circulation and sunlight penetration. Proper pruning helps maintain the overall structure of the tree, making it easier to harvest fruit and reducing the risk of branch breakage during storms or heavy winds. Skilled service providers use specific techniques to encourage the development of strong, productive branches while maintaining the tree’s natural shape.

Pruning apple trees can also address common problems such as overgrowth, which can lead to weak branches and decreased fruit yield. It helps prevent the spread of pests and diseases by removing compromised wood and improving airflow around the canopy. Additionally, pruning can help control the size of the tree, making it easier to manage and harvest. Regular maintenance through pruning ensures the tree remains healthy and vigorous, reducing the likelihood of issues that may require more extensive intervention later on.

The overview below groups typical Apple Tree Pruning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Sebring,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small Tree Pruning - Typical costs range from $150-$400 for routine trimming of small trees or shrubs. Many local pros handle these smaller jobs regularly within this range, which covers basic maintenance and shaping.

Medium Tree Pruning - Larger, more involved pruning projects generally cost between $400-$1,200. These projects often include shaping or removing branches from medium-sized trees and are common for ongoing landscape care.

Large Tree Pruning - Extensive pruning of large trees can range from $1,200-$3,000 or more. Fewer projects reach this level, typically involving significant branch removal or safety-related trimming for mature trees.

Full Tree Removal - Complete removal of a tree usually costs $500-$5,000+ depending on size and complexity. Larger, more complex projects or those involving hazardous trees tend to fall into the higher end of this range.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of pruning apple trees? Proper pruning helps maintain tree health, encourages better fruit production, and improves overall tree structure.

When is the best time to prune apple trees? The ideal time for pruning is typically during late winter or early spring before new growth begins.

How do local contractors determine the right pruning approach? They assess the tree's age, health, and growth patterns to develop suitable pruning strategies.

What tools are used for apple tree pruning? Professional service providers often use pruning shears, loppers, and saws to ensure precise cuts.

Can pruning help prevent pests and diseases in apple trees? Yes, removing dead or diseased branches can reduce the risk of pest infestations and infections.
